WebMar 18, 2011 · The amount of vitamin E in supplements also may be a factor. In the United States, the median daily intake of vitamin E from food is about 5 to 10 milligrams (mg). Vitamin E supplements generally contain 268 or 537 mg (400 or 800 international units). WebJan 13, 2024 · Most people take the recommended dose of 15 mg (22.5 IU) daily without any side effects. However, it should be noted that possible side effects reported after taking high doses of vitamin E include: nausea, diarrhea, stomach cramps, fatigue, weakness, headache, sarcosinuria, blurred vision, rash, bruising, and bleeding.
